Quote:
Originally Posted by cowmeat View Post
How did the lights do for visibility? They look super bright in the pic!
They are lot brighter than my 45w Sylvania EcoBright or 55w OEM, they spread the light wider and further. But they suck in rain and the high beam are shy.

Quote:
Originally Posted by cowmeat View Post
Also, I'm gonna ask cause I'm too impatient to read the whole thread, do they pull less juice than the OEM lights, and are they Insight-specific, or generic?
They pull 25w each instead of 55w OEM. The LED headlights kits are generic but I think they are more f*ck it yourself.

Of course I will try to do a 100 mpg tank!

I'm at 98.9 right now .

This is because I charge my battery every two commute. I only use assist when I do a pulse and I never do regen if it is not in DFCO. So there is a lot of outside grid energy in my results. The mpg equivalent would be a nice thing to consider. Would need a kill-a-watt.

Did a trip to Lac Nominingue this weekend. 214 mi mostly on mountaineous area. Average speed : 75 km/h | 46.6 mph. Lot of hill climbing and downshifting required. Did P&G in the low speed zones and DWL on the highway. Tried to stay near 110 mpg at 50-55 mph. Did P&G on the last 15 km of the highway on the returning trip. My well-balanced battery did great in the mountain. I never had a forced regen or recal. Did 3 cycles of the battery on the go an returning trip.

I also could plug at the place so I charged it there to. Here is a pic the trip FCD :


My tank average went from 98.9 mpg to 93 mpg
